Rickarby, Mobile, AL Local Guide
How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Rickarby?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rickarby Studio Apartments | $1,085 | $600 | $1,620 |
Rickarby 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,648 | $695 | $2,345 |
| Rickarby 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,782 | $757 | $2,785 |
| Rickarby 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,262 | $1,081 | $4,518 |
| Rickarby 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,624 | $4,219 | $5,259 |

Cheapest Available Rickarby 1 Bedroom Apartments
Currently the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it Rickarby of Mobile, AL is the Midtown Model starting from $810 at Old Shell Commons.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Rickarby is currently $1,648.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Old Shell Commons | Midtown | $810 |
| Bel Air | 650sf | $885 |
| Midtown Commons Apartments | One Bedroom/ One Bath | $900 |
| Ann Street Lofts | The Ann at Ann St. Lofts | $1,017 |
| Parkside at Cottage Hill | Sanderling II | $1,244 |
| The Waters at McGowin | The Merlot | $1,343 |
| The Portier Midtown | Atticus | $1,650 |
